WHAT ABOUT ALCOHOL AND PROZAC?
A general medical principle is that even nonalcoholics should drink only moderately or not at all while taking any medications, including Prozac. After being stabilized on Prozac or other antidepressants, patients who do not have an alcohol problem are permitted to have a glass of wine at dinner, provided that no adverse effects on judgment or mood take place. Obviously, patients who are taking Prozac or any other psychotropic drugs should not use alcohol prior to driving. Most medical authorities argue that no alcohol should be used by anyone who plans to drive.
If the patient is alcoholic, as is often the case with those suffering from major depression, dysthymia, and bipolar manic depression (due to a genetic alcoholic predisposition), it is imperative to abstain from alcohol completely. Interestingly, a least one study suggests that a dosage of 60 mg of Prozac may cause heavy drinkers to drink less alcohol but not to smoke fewer cigarettes.
